WebDec 26, 2024 · The neutral flame has a nearly equal mix (1:1) of oxygen and fuel gas (e.g., Acetylene or LPG), resulting in a somewhat “neutral” combustion. This type of flame is used for most general purpose welding applications. While the neutral flame is the most common type of gas welding flame, it is not always the best choice for every situation.
